In electric water heaters, lukewarm water usually means the upper element is functioning but the lower element has burned out. In gas units, it often indicates a damaged dip tube or a miscalibrated thermostat control.
Condensation is common when a cold tank is filled with water during initial startup. However, continuous dripping beneath the tank after hours of heating indicates an internal tank leak requiring immediate inspection.

A typical family of 4 to 5 requires a 50-gallon gas water heater or a 55 to 80-gallon electric tank (or a tankless unit producing 7.5 to 9.5 gallons per minute) to ensure sufficient first-hour hot water capacity.
